VIC Parkes Street, McCrae

Yindyamarra, set beside Arthurs Seat on the Mornington Peninsula, enjoys panoramic views across Port Phillip Bay. The four-bedroom home has a cantilevered pavilion, floor-to-ceiling glazing, a suspended Oblica fireplace and a chef’s kitchen with a concealed scullery and premium appliances. Native gardens and easy access to surrounding bushland create a serene experience. Walking tracks and cafés are nearby, and it’s 90km to Melbourne. Kay & Burton, 0418 446 228. $8-$8.8 million

NSW Augustine Street, Hunters Hill

Marika is a grand 1904 estate in Sydney that’s been transformed for modern living. Framed by manicured gardens and glimpses of the Harbour Bridge, the five-bedroom home has wraparound verandahs, high ceilings, ornate fireplaces and original timber floors. A modern extension flows to an open-plan living area, outdoor kitchen and covered alfresco space. It’s set on 2472sqm with a pool, tennis court and self-contained studio. BresicWhitney, 0402 472 062. $7.5 million

QLD Molonga Terrace, Graceville

Set on an 812sqm block fronting the Brisbane River, this newly built home has full-height glass to frame the water views, two outdoor kitchens, a poolside terrace and a bar lounge made for the subtropical climate. The luxe interior features a kitchen with Wolf and Subzero appliances, Esmeralda marble, premium cabinetry and high ceilings. All four bedrooms have walk-in robes and ensuites, and the tiered landscaped garden leads to a firepit and a pontoon. McGrath, 0410 424 749. $5-$5.5 million

SA Signal Flat Road, Finniss

Vale House, an 1860s homestead on 68ha, is still held by descendants of the original land grantees. The three-bedroom stone house has 3.5m ceilings, timber floors, leadlight windows, open fireplaces and 21st-century aircon. Infrastructure includes a workshop, outbuildings, solar panels and stock yards, along with a bore and abundant water entitlements from the Finniss River, which is lined with century-old red gums. Adelaide is an hour’s drive away to the north. Southgate, 0438 323 933. $2 million

TAS Manresa Court, Sandy Bay

Bold angles, timber accents and corrugated steel define this cleverly designed home, which follows the contours of its sloping 893sqm block in Hobart’s south. It has four bedrooms, high ceilings and a mezzanine level. Highlight windows, polished concrete floors and a galley kitchen flow through to a light-filled living and a north-facing deck that opens onto a plunge pool. A separate studio with its own bathroom is great for teens or guests. LJ Hooker, 0408 621 856. $1.1 million-plus
